Chapter 8 - The Pulled Chair

The cruelty began during the family toast.

Evelyn seated Margaret at the farthest table near the service doors.

When Isabella moved her mother closer, Jason objected.

“That table is reserved for important guests.”

“My mother is important.”

Jason leaned toward her.

“Don’t start.”

Margaret attempted to leave quietly.

Isabella caught her arm.

“You’re staying.”

A server brought another chair.

Margaret lowered herself carefully because of an old hip injury.

Jason stepped behind her.

He looked toward Evelyn.

His mother gave the smallest nod.

Then Jason pulled the chair away.

Margaret crashed onto the marble.

Guests gasped.

Jason spoke loudly enough for everyone to hear.

“Trash needs to know its place!”

Evelyn pointed toward the doors.

“Get out! You don’t belong here!”

Margaret’s eyes filled with shame.

“I’m sorry,” she whispered to Isabella. “I embarrassed you.”

That sentence ended the performance.

Isabella rose and ordered Jason to apologize.

He laughed.

She slapped him.

For the first time, the ballroom saw the rage behind Jason’s polished smile.

“You’ll regret that,” he whispered.

Isabella signaled toward the security camera above the ballroom doors.

“No, Jason.”

“You will.”

Helen and the attorneys entered.

Behind them came hotel security and Investigator Paul Ramirez.
